Who is Chris Tucker?
Born on August 31, 1971, in Atlanta, Georgia, Chris Tucker’s comedic aspirations emerged early. Influenced by comedy legends like Eddie Murphy and Richard Pryor, Tucker transitioned from Atlanta comedy clubs to prominence on “Def Comedy Jam”. His breakthrough role arrived in 1994 with “House Party 3”, leading to a series of high-profile projects including “Friday” and “The Fifth Element”.

Early Life
Chris Tucker was born to Mary Louise and Norris Tucker, owners of a janitorial service. He was the youngest of six children, using comedy to gain attention at an early age. Tucker’s early life was marked by a strong support system, with his parents encouraging his comedic pursuits.
Career
Tucker’s career skyrocketed after the monumental success of the first “Rush Hour”, ultimately earning him a $20 million deal for the sequel. Later, he inked a groundbreaking two-movie contract worth $40 million with New Line Cinema, solidifying his position as the world’s highest-paid actor at the time. Tucker’s film career has been punctuated by notable roles in “The Fifth Element”, “Money Talks”, and “Silver Linings Playbook”.
Financial Troubles
Despite his lucrative earnings, Tucker’s net worth faced a downward spiral due to financial blunders. In 2011, he grappled with an overwhelming $11 million IRS tax debt spanning multiple years, eventually escalating to $14 million by 2014. However, Tucker managed to resolve this debt in 2014.
Florida Mansion Foreclosure
In 2007, Tucker purchased a 10,000-square-foot lakefront mansion in Central Florida for $6 million. However, the IRS placed a lien on the home in 2011, leading to a foreclosure in 2012. Tucker sold the property for $1.7 million, incurring a significant loss.

“Friday” Paycheck
In December 2021, Ice Cube revealed that Chris Tucker declined a $10-12 million offer to appear in “Next Friday” due to religious reasons.
Other work and Appearances
Tucker has hosted numerous programs, including the 2013 BET Awards and the 2020 Urban One Honors. He has also participated in various NBA All-Star Celebrity basketball games and founded the Chris Tucker Foundation to impact youth health and education.
Personal Life
Chris Tucker is a born-again Christian and abstains from using profanity in his comedy acts. His strong convictions also played a role in declining offers to reprise his role in “Friday” sequels. Tucker’s personal life reflects a balance between faith and fame. Azja Pryor is his Ex-wife and he has one son.
